main ComponenTs oF eleCTriC VeHiCle
Main Components of Electric
Vehicle
• On-Board Charger (OBC) : A device
that charges the high voltage battery
by converting AC power from a
charging station to DC power. Inverter
: A device that transforms direct
current (DC) from the high voltage
battery into alternating current (AC)
to supply power to the electric motor
and transforms AC back into DC when
available to charge the high voltage
battery.
• LDC : An LDC is a Low Voltage DC-to-
DC converter that transforms power
from the high voltage battery to the
low voltage battery (12V) in order
to supply electrical power to the
vehicle to operate the lights, wipers,
multimedia, etc.
• Electric Motor : A device that
converts electrical energy from the
high voltage battery into mechanical
energy which is then transferred as
rotational torque to the wheels in
order to drive the vehicle.
• Reduction gear : Delivers rotational
force of the motor to the tires at
appropriate speeds and torque.
• EV Battery (Lithium-ion) : On board
high voltage storage device with a
capacity up to 64 kWh

High Voltage Battery
(lithium-ion polymer)
• The charge amount of the high
voltage battery may gradually
decrease when the vehicle is not
being driven.
• The battery capacity of the high
voltage battery may decrease when
the vehicle is stored in high/low
temperatures.
• Electric range may vary depending
on the driving conditions, even if the
charge amount is the same. The high
voltage battery may expend more
energy when driving at high speed or
uphill. These actions may reduce the
vehicle electric range.
• The high voltage battery is used when
using the air-conditioner / heater. This
may reduce the vehicle range. Make
sure to set moderate temperatures
when using the air-conditioner/heater.
• Natural degradation may occur with
the high voltage battery depending
on the number of years the vehicle
is used. This may reduce the vehicle
range.

Flatbed Towing
Tires Locked Towing
DollyTires Locked Towing
Dolly
• If towing is required, lift all four
wheels off the ground and tow the
vehicle. If you must tow the vehicle
using only two wheels, lift the front
wheels off the ground and tow the
vehicle.
If necessary to roll the vehicle so that
it can be rolled onto a flatbed tow
truck perform the following:
- First, depress the brake pedal and
release the parking brake.
- While depressing the brake pedal
shift to the N (Neutral) position and
press the POWER button to turn
the vehicle off.
- Wait 3 minutes or more before
opening the driver door and the
vehicle will remain in ACC mode
and in Neutral.
- If the driver door is opened within
the 3 minute period, the vehicle
will automatically shift to P (Park),
the vehicle will turn OFF and the
front wheels will be remained
locked.
WARNING
OOS067022
• If you tow the vehicle while the
front wheels are touching the
ground, the vehicle motor may
generate electricity and the motor
components may be damaged or a
fire may occur.
• When a vehicle fire occurs due to the
battery, there is a risk of a second
fire. Contact the fire department
when towing the vehicle.

NOTICE
• It is permissible to add 20 kPa (3 psi) to the standard tire pressure specification if
colder temperatures are expected soon. Tires typically lose 7 kPa (1 psi) for every
7°C (12°F) temperature drop. If extreme temperature variations are expected,
recheck your tire pressures as necessary to keep them properly inflated.
• As air pressure generally decreases, as you drive up to a high-altitude area above
sea level. Thus, if you plan to drive a high-altitude area, check the tire pressures in
advance. If necessary, inflate them to a proper level (Air inflation per altitude: +10
kPa/1 km (+2.4 psi/1 mile)).
CAUTION
When replacing tires, ALWAYS use the same size, type, brand, construction and
tread pattern supplied with the vehicle. If not, replaced tires can damage the related
parts or make them work irregularly.

Low Tire Pressure Warning
Light
This warning light illuminates:
•
When the START/STOP button is in the ON position.
- It illuminates for approximately 3 seconds and then goes off.
• When one or more of your tires are
significantly underinflated (The
location of the underinflated tires are
displayed on the LCD display).
For more details, refer to “Tire Pressure
Monitoring System (TPMS)” in chapter 8.
This warning light remains on after
blinking for approximately 60 seconds
or repeatedly blinks on and off at
approximately 3 second intervals:
• When there is a malfunction with the TPMS.
In this case, we recommend that
you have the vehicle inspected by an
authorized HYUNDAI dealer as soon as possible.
For more details, refer to “Tire Pressure
Monitoring System (TPMS)” in chapter 8.

Driving with wheels and tires with
different sizes may cause ESC to
malfunction. Before replacing tires,
make sure all four tires and wheels are
the same size. Never drive the vehicle
with different sized wheels and tires
installed. ESC OFF usage
When Driving
The ESC OFF mode should only be used
briefly to help free the vehicle if stuck in
snow or mud, by temporarily stopping
operation of ESC, to maintain wheel
torque.
To turn ESC off while driving, press the
ESC OFF button while driving on a flat
road surface.
NOTICE
• Do not allow wheel(s) of one axle to
spin excessively while the ESC, ABS,
and parking brake warning lights
are displayed. The repairs would not
be covered by the vehicle warranty.
Reduce vehicle power and do not
spin the wheel(s) excessively while
these lights are displayed.
• When operating the vehicle
on a dynamometer, make sure
ESC is turned off (ESC OFF light
illuminated).
Information
Turning ESC off does not affect ABS or standard brake system operation.
Vehicle Stability Management
(VSM)
Vehicle Stability Management (VSM)
is a function of the Electronic Stability
Control (ESC). It helps ensure the
vehicle stays stable when accelerating
or braking suddenly on wet, slippery
and rough roads where traction over the
four tires can suddenly become uneven.
WARNING
Take the following precautions when
using Vehicle Stability Management
(VSM): • ALWAYS check the speed and the
distance to the vehicle ahead. VSM
is not a substitute for safe driving
practices.
• Never drive too fast for the road
conditions. VSM will not prevent
accidents. Excessive speed in bad
weather, on slippery and uneven
roads can result in severe accidents.
VSM operation
VSM ON condition
VSM operates when: • Electronic Stability Control (ESC) is on.
• Vehicle speed is approximately under
150 km/h (93 mph) when the vehicle is
braking on rough roads.
When operating
When you apply your brakes under
conditions which may activate ESC, you
may hear sounds from the brakes, or feel
a corresponding sensation in the brake
pedal. This is normal and it means your
VSM is active.
